Yes. They have to be careful, as they may have to build up their level of exercise. They can't just do it at a high level to start. They will need advice from their doctor. Every individual is different. If they are extremely obese, they won't be able to go out and start jogging 5 miles a day. They have to have a planned program of exercise to follow and their progress has to be monitored. They will also need to be doing something about their diet at the same time. They won't achieve much by exercising while maintaining the same diet they have. Their diet can help their exercise if everything is planned.

There is a possibility of exercise burnout if an exercise program is not varied and adequate rest periods are not taken between exercise sessions. Muscle, joint, and cardiac disorders have been noted among people who exercise.
